Battery
The easiest way to fix the battery in your key fob is to replace it. The fob has a tiny coin-shaped 3V battery (CR2032 or CR2025) that is usually easily found in general stores and home improvement stores, and even some auto parts stores. You should use a new battery. Old batteries can damage the circuit boards and cease to be useful.
You'll need to start by opening the fob. It might be a bit tight but with the help of a flat screwdriver, you should be able separate the halves. After that, slide the screwdriver in the seam on all sides of the fob, and then lift up a couple of clips that hold it in place. They are easily broken therefore, take your time and work slowly.
Reassemble the fob after replacing the battery, and check to see if it functions as it should. If it still doesn't work Try pressing the button several times before confirming that the contacts are in good order. It is also possible to test it with a spare key fob to determine whether the issue is confined to the specific key. If it isn't the case, there could be another reason for why your key fob isn't functioning. For instance, it could be that the button is worn out. This would make the button function occasionally but not constantly.
Interference
The key fob is an insignificant transmitter to send a short-range radio signal to a receiver within your car. Its goal is to enable your vehicle to recognize the key fob and open its doors as you approach it, and begin when you press the ignition button.
The problem is, interference can sometimes hinder the transmission. For instance, if have your second-generation Apple Pencil charged while you're holding the fob, it might stop you from unlocking the car (via iGeneration).
Other electronic devices that operate on the same frequency may also interfere with the fob's signal. Garage door openers or tire-pressure monitoring devices could be affected. A transmitter in your home could be interfering however this is not easy for professionals to test.
Your key fob may also require reprogramming. The transmitter in your key fob has to be recognized by mini cooper key programming's receiver. A unique code is then used for each pairing. Fobs typically need to be reprogrammed when they're disconnected or replaced, when you purchase a replacement, and in some cases the battery is changed. Follow the steps in your owner’s manual to reprogram a key fob or ask a dealer for help.
